What factors are considered when evaluating U.S. universities, and how reliable are current rankings?

That's an interesting topic. The criteria used to evaluate universities vary by ranking. For nationwide rankings, factors like class size, teacher salaries, and the number of faculty members with advanced degrees in their field are common considerations. If a ranking focuses on student satisfaction, the criteria will differ. However, rankings don't always align with individual student needs and should be considered alongside other factors.

Accommodation, meals, prices

Residence Arizona State University (ASU) - Downtown Phoenix Campus is located on the campus, near the School of Journalism and Mass Communication, within walking distance of several restaurants and shops.

Student residence Taylor Place is a modern and comfortable hostel, the infrastructure of which includes:

  • Laundry
  • Tv
  • Terrace
  • Recreation areas
  • A park.

Student room - standard rooms with a shared or separate bathroom, wardrobe, single bed, desk, chair, bookshelves, mirror

Cost of living in a residence:

  • Room for 1 with shared bathroom - $ 10180 per year
  • Room for 1 with a private bathroom - $ 10180 per year
  • Room for 2 people - $ 9440 per year

Students can choose a nutrition plan:

  • Unlimited meals - $ 5,510 per year
  • 14 meals per week - $ 5180 per year
  • 8 meals a week - $ 2970 a year.

Recommendations on when to apply

Language courses, schools and children's language camps Primary and secondary education - private schools Preparation programmes for entering universities - higher education Higher education (after completing accredited programs A-level, IB, High School) - Bachelor, Master, MBA
- we recommend to apply 6-9 months before the start of the course (some camps and schools offer discounts for early booking or for lengthy study programs)
- there are some very popular and high demand children's camps, where the applications need to be submitted 1 year in advance (in particular Switzerland , Great Britain , USA , Canada , Austria)
- we recommend to apply one year before the start of the training program,
- some schools have a specific time frame (September-November - please specify an individual school)
- some schools require tests in several stages (UKISET, internal tests of the school: English, mathematics, logics, subjects, interview, some require a personal visit)
- we recommend to apply one year before the start of the program,
- for Foundation and Pathway programs, IELTS and TOEFL certificates are usually required, respectively

- recommended submission one year before the start of the program,
- the deadline normally closes in January, for TOP HEIs and, as a rule, in March in other universities
- for a bachelor, a Foundation or Pathway preparatory program a completed A-level, IB, High School + IELTS / TOEFL are required
- for Masters you need a graduated higher education, in some cases you need a pre-Masters program
- MBA requires completed higher education, work experience preferably at least 2-3 years, etc.
